What to check before for buildings highly rated for heat near the B train in NYC

  • Expect more consistent heat-focused signals on these buildings—still confirm specifics for your exact unit (exposure, radiator type, thermostat control).
  • Before applying, ask the building how heat is delivered (radiators vs. central), average warm-up time, and what happens during outages or maintenance.
  • Check lease language and any utility arrangement: confirm what you pay and whether heat is included in the monthly cost.
  • Compare building timing: ask whether heat issues are handled through onsite maintenance, and how fast requests are typically addressed.
  • If you’re sensitive to temperature swings, ask about seasonal history and whether units vary by floor or orientation.
